Plantscapers donated a Living Wall to their charity of choice, the Orange County Ronald McDonald House.

The Orange County Ronald McDonald House has been bringing families together for 26 years. Katie Russell is Director of Operations and along with her staff, they have been running a household that gives families, whose sick children are receiving treatments, a warm and comforting place to stay. The home environment replaces the option of a cold hospital bench, impersonal hotel room or miles of traveling back and forth that many families go through when their child is in the hospital. Orange County Ronald McDonald House lessens the burdens for these families by keeping the entire family together to rest and refresh in a place filled with kindness and love.

After a partial remodel due to a faulty fire sprinkler that accidentally went off inside the home, Katie wanted something more that brought the soothing nature of the outdoors, indoors.

Interior designer Tamra Mundia of Concept Design (see Plantscaper’s January Client of the Month) who helped design the remodel suggested a living wall and recommended Plantscapers. We were delighted to give a wall to such a fantastic charity! And during the process we decided this was our charity of choice and will be participating in the many fundraising projects for Orange County Ronald McDonald House.

What really touched our hearts and made it plain as day the value of plants indoors, was the comment made by a mother getting through her child’s sickness one day at a time. Every morning she would quietly sit in front of the living wall and sip her cup of coffee. She remarked the wall soothed her, “it brings me peace.” And so it is for many other families that gather in this very special place to relax.

Katie has been with the Orange County Ronald McDonald House for over ten years and during her tenure has held a variety of positions such as: Guest Services Associate, Volunteer Coordinator, and Guest Services Manager. Her previous work experience includes serving as Director of Operations for an Interior Design Company and over nine years with the Disneyland Resort as a Guest Relations Manager.
